7-Day Culinary Journey in Dubrovnik, Croatia

Restaurant List

Day 1

Gradska Kavana Arsenal Breakfast
€8-€15, 1 hour

Start your day with a picturesque breakfast overlooking the old harbor. Enjoy fresh pastries, Croatian coffee, and traditional Dalmatian breakfast options.

Nautika Restaurant Lunch
€25-€40, 1.5 hours

Lunch by the sea with amazing views of the Adriatic. Specializes in fresh seafood including oysters and black risotto, true Dalmatian flavors.

Proto Dinner
€35-€50, 2 hours

Elegant dinner near the city walls featuring traditional Dubrovnik cuisine with a focus on fresh seafood and Mediterranean dishes, paired with Croatian wine.
